Description

Manti Extra is a combination of three active substances: famotidine, used to reduce the production of hydrochloric acid in the stomach, and two antacids (reducing the concentration of stomach acid) - calcium carbonate and magnesium hydroxide. Manti Extra is intended to alleviate the symptoms of indigestion or stomach hyperacidity.

The active ingredients in Manti Extra work in two ways: calcium carbonate and magnesium hydroxide work by quickly neutralizing excess acid already produced in the stomach, leading to rapid pain relief, while famotidine inhibits the production of hydrochloric acid in the stomach and exerts more long-lasting effect, reducing the acidity of gastric juice for 10-12 hours. The combination of these two actions effectively maintains proper acidity in the stomach, allowing the soothing of the irritated mucosa.

Indications

Manti Extra is used in adults and adolescents over 16 years of age for the short-term symptomatic treatment of ailments related to hyperacidity of gastric juice, such as:

  • heartburn,
  • dyspepsia,
  • pain and burning in the epigastrium.

Contraindications

When not to use Manti Extra:

  • If you are allergic to famotidine, magnesium hydroxide, calcium carbonate or any of the other ingredients of this medicine
  • If you are allergic to other medicines that lower hydrochloric acid levels (such as ranitidine, cimetidine etc.);
  • If you suffer from kidney failure;
  • Children and adolescents under 16 years of age should not take Manti Extra;
  • If you are pregnant or breastfeeding.

Precautions

Talk to your doctor or pharmacist before taking Manti Extra if you have:

  • Pain in the chest (or around the shoulders), shallow breathing, sweating, pain radiating to the upper limbs, neck, shoulders or jaw (especially if accompanied by difficulty breathing);
  • Difficulty swallowing and pain when swallowing;
  • Dizziness, nausea, vomiting;
  • Vomitus that is bloody or looks like coffee grounds;
  • Bleeding or blood in the stool, black stools;
  • Heartburn lasting longer than 3 months;
  • Heartburn combined with pain, dizziness and excessive sweating;
  • Persistent abdominal pain;
  • Unexpected weight loss;
  • If you are over 40 years old and have recently developed new or changed symptoms of indigestion or heartburn.

Contact your doctor:

  • if the patient has a stomach or duodenal ulcer, cancer should be ruled out (Manti Extra, by relieving the symptoms, may delay the diagnosis of the underlying disease);
  • if the patient uses other drugs used to treat gastric hyperacidity;
  • if you are taking non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s;
  • if you have had a peptic ulcer in the past or have any disturbing symptoms such as unintentional weight loss, difficulty swallowing, repeated vomiting, blood or grounds vomiting, melaena;
  • if you have confirmed hypercalcemia (increase in the amount of calcium in the body) because the product contains calcium;
  • if you have confirmed hypophosphatemia (decrease in the amount of phosphorus in the body), as the product may worsen this condition;
  • if the patient has confirmed hypercalciuria (increased urinary excretion of calcium) or urinary tract stones;
  • if the patient has impaired kidney function, the product should only be administered under medical supervision, and serum calcium and magnesium levels should be monitored;
  • in case of impaired liver or kidney function, Manti Extra should be used with caution;
  • in case of long-term use, especially during treatment with other calcium-containing drugs and/or vitamin D-containing drugs, due to the risk of increased calcium levels in the blood with the subsequent development of renal failure.

Application

Always use this medicine exactly as described in this leaflet or as your doctor or pharmacist has told you. If you have any doubts, ask your doctor or pharmacist.


Dosage:

Adults and adolescents over 16 years of age: chew one tablet to relieve symptoms.

Children and adolescents under 16 years of age should not take Manti Extra.

Do not swallow the tablet whole.

To prevent heartburn, take one tablet 15 to 60 minutes before taking food or drink that causes indigestion.

The maximum daily dose is two tablets.

Do not take this medicine for longer than 15 days without consulting your doctor.

If symptoms do not improve after 15 days of continuous treatment, or if they worsen, contact your doctor.

Composition

The active substances of the drug are: Famotidine 10 mg, Magnesium hydroxide 165 mg, Calcium carbonate 800 mg.

The other ingredients are: pregelatinized corn starch, corn starch, dextrates, sodium carboxymethyl starch (type A), sodium cyclamate (E 952), mint flavor SD (gum arabic, flavorings, natural flavorings including L-menthol) , magnesium stearate.
